Output c23e66377ea66f805267757373af10df1c862e6107c15d097557945bbcf919c6:2

value
13642565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7363c633b92aa8990e331d557be65bc4ab62347d OP_EQUAL
address
MJRHTvdcZLyB878hrpoFdsgM3SfyEZQDQw
transaction
c23e66377ea66f805267757373af10df1c862e6107c15d097557945bbcf919c6
spent
true